Cognitive Functioning In Well-Controlled Asthma, Erin Walsh Jan 2024

Cognitive Functioning In Well-Controlled Asthma, Erin Walsh

West Chester University Doctoral Projects

Asthma is a common lung disease that impacts lung functioning through inflammatory based mechanisms. Past research suggests that decreased blood oxygenation due to asthma attacks may impair cognitive capabilities (Irani et al., 2017). Moreover, the observed differences in cognition between those with and without asthma may be associated with disease severity or asthma control respectively in asthma populations. The current study explored differences in cognitive functioning between college students with and without self-reported asthma. Sociodemographic data, self-reported asthma severity, and measures of asthma control were collected. Relationships Between Age And White Matter Integrity In Children With Phenylketonuria, Erika M. Wesonga Aug 2015

Relationships Between Age And White Matter Integrity In Children With Phenylketonuria, Erika M. Wesonga

Arts & Sciences Electronic Theses and Dissertations

Objective: Phenylketonuria (PKU) is a hereditary metabolic disorder associated with cognitive compromise. Diffusion tensor imaging (DTI) has allowed detection of poorer microstructural white matter integrity in children with PKU, with decreased mean diffusivity (MD) in comparison with healthy children. However, very little research has been conducted to examine the trajectory of white matter development in this population. The present study investigated potential differences in the developmental trajectory of MD between children with early- and continuously-treated PKU and healthy children across a range of brain regions.

Cholinergic Basal Forebrain Involvement In The Acquisition Of Differential Reinforcement Of Low Rate Responding Tasks In Rats, Sean Ryan Corley Jan 2005

Cholinergic Basal Forebrain Involvement In The Acquisition Of Differential Reinforcement Of Low Rate Responding Tasks In Rats, Sean Ryan Corley

Theses Digitization Project

It was hypothesized that 192 IgG-saporin lesions of the basal forebrain cholinergic system (BFCS) would disrupt differential reinforcement of low rate (DRL) learning in an uncued DRL task, but would not impair acquisition and performance in the cued version of the task. Results suggest that BFCS lesions impair vigilance to the external cues despite continued practice in the cued DRL, whereas continuous attention to internally produced cues recovers with extended practice in the uncued DRL.
